Offered to an honored friend of the community to mark a moment and then hung prominently, this sign proclaims “prosperity for posterity” beautifully scripted in gold ink. Made of northern elmwood, the sign is covered all over with chips of mica, a mineral that was frequently used for its glistening properties during the 19th century in Fujian province.
